Edwin Earl “Ed” Catmull (born March 31, 1945) is an American computer scientist who is the co-founder of Pixar and was the President of Walt Disney Animation Studios. He has been honored for his contributions to 3D computer graphics, including the 2019 ACM Turing Award.

Edwin Catmull was born on March 31, 1945, in Parkersburg, West Virginia. His family later moved to Salt Lake City, Utah, where his father first served as principal of Granite High School and then of Taylorsville High School.

Early in life, Catmull found inspiration in Disney movies, including Peter Pan and Pinocchio, and dreamed[vague] of becoming a feature film animator. He also made animation using flip-books. Catmull graduated in 1969, with a B.S. in physics and computer science from the University of Utah. Initially interested in designing programming languages, Catmull encountered Ivan Sutherland, who had designed the computer drawing program Sketchpad, and changed[vague]his interest to digital imaging. As a student of Sutherland, he was part of the university’s ARPA program, sharing classes with James H. Clark, John Warnock and Alan Kay.
